you really cant do a leaf SAS and keep it low. even if you build your spring pack, the spring pack would pretty much be flat to get the low stance you want. this will result in lots of neg arch and broken spring. the hanger alone will add an inch to an already low hanging frame.

if you want to keep it low, you would have to link it but that will cost much more. i think a built link will run you around what a completely built ifs would go for.

Frenched means to cut into the frame and mount the springs inside of the frame. Then you would reinforce the frame around the mounts so the frame isn't weak in that area. For a front spring setup that is not necessary because the front hangar can be mounted an inch or two in front of the frame. The rear shackle is already drilled into the frame so there really isn't anything to "french" into the frame for the front.

The rear can be frenched in on the frame though. Did you think that my 87 was high? I think that your 4runner is no lower than my 87. So if you're comfortable with that height then there is no reason to start cutting into your frame.

right, that would be for the rear.
and for the front, you can drill the shackle holes towards the top of the frame, instead of the middle, and run extra long shackles.

keeps you low, and still lets the suspension work.

you really cant do a leaf SAS and keep it low.

That depends on your definition of low. If you're talking a frame height of 20" with 35" tires, then you're hard pressed to accomplish that with leaf springs. But if your definition is 25-26" frame height with 35" tires then that is realistic and easily doable. Heck, I think we can get his frame height down to 23-24" on his 35's.

Either way, let's not forget that he already has a 2-3" lift. Adding a solid axle doesn't mean it's going to be 3" higher than what it already is. We can even make it a few inches LOWER than what it is if he wanted to get extreme with it. We can always cut the frame just before the front body mount and raise it up and build some new motor mounts to accommodate the new frame height. We can also do the same for the rear. Doing that we are essentially raising the suspension into the vehicle more. The military hummers are designed the same way. That's how they're able to run 37" tires and still have a vehicle that is VERY low. Granted, these vehicles are IFS but the concept is the same.
 
I wanted to mount my hanger higher but when doing so you point your pinion at the ground. So unless your clocking the the balls or cutting the perches off and re welding. Your efforts in keeping it low result in a pinion angle with vibrations or getting into rocks.

the reason to run low steer is that histeer requires at least 3 inch lift springs otherwise the tie rod will hit the spring and cause binding. Really the low steer is a good way to go for a lot of people. Some of the advantages of running low steer are that they are much less prone to arms coming loose, there is not binding of the tie rod on low lift springs. the down side is that the tie rod takes a lot of abuse and you loose some cool factor. But honestly some beefy .250 wall tubing will hold the truck up without bending. I have a friend who was like the 3rd SAS in the country on a Toyota and is still running low steer with 37's and has wheeled some of the hardest trails that aren't secret undertaker trails and never had a problem.

I thought about this a lot when I had the '86. Low Range sells a pitman already set up for an LC80 tie rod end, and a reamer sized for the LC80 TRE studs - you could ream out your stock spindles, build a new tie rod from DOM, and run LC80 outer TREs on the outside and on the pitman. SDORI/4Crawler makes a set of bushings for the stock idler, or you could drop coin on a Total Chaos idler, or put SV's mad fabrication skillz to work and make your own from DOM and greasable bushings and run an LC80 tie rod end there too.

I'd rethink the limited slip in front though. Half the times I needed it I had a front wheel unloaded and it was useless anyway. If I had that to do again I'd save up for ARB for sure.

But no matter what you do, the CV shaft is still going to be your weak link, and unless you go to Porsche or RCV shafts there's not much to be done about that except get good at changing them. So you know me and my random habit of spitting out ideas with which I have done no research. What about using the IFS off a T100 or Tundra? Are they any stronger, or still just IFS?

The T100 front diff is the same diff you've got, just with longer CV shafts. That's why the long travel conversion works - extend your control arms to match the T100 cv shafts, and poof, long travel.
